So you want to become a Cloud Solutions Architect...
Know these challenges and how to address them
Hey there 👋 - Amrut here!
Happy Sunday to all synced with The Tech Pulse!
Are you interested in becoming a Cloud Solutions Architect?
I have been a Cloud Architect for over 3 years, architecting and managing SaaS applications on AWS Cloud.
Cloud Solutions Architect requires various skills like programming, system design, and business domain understanding. It is not just drawing architecture diagrams and having teams implement them.
In today’s newsletter, I will discuss the challenges of becoming an AWS Cloud Solutions Architect.
I will share my learnings and essential skills one needs to develop to succeed in this role.
Let’s dive in!
Challenges of Becoming an AWS Cloud Solutions Architect
Technical Complexity
Cloud platforms offer many services, from computing, storage, and networking to advanced machine learning and AI tools.
Navigating this vast ecosystem, understanding the interplay between services, and mastering their configurations can be overwhelming.
You can begin with foundational services and gradually expand your knowledge. Use online platforms like the AWS Learning Library to undergo structured learning.
Regular hands-on practice and real-world project exposure can solidify understanding.
Certifications and Continuous Learning
You can begin by achieving certifications like AWS Certified Solutions Architect requires intensive study.
Additionally, cloud platforms evolve rapidly, necessitating continuous learning.
Set clear timelines for certification preparations.
Join study groups, use practice exams, and regularly consult the cloud provider's official documentation.
Attend webinars, workshops, and industry conferences to stay updated.
Also, please continue to read my newsletter. 😉
Understanding Business Needs
An architect must translate business requirements into technical solutions.
This requires understanding industry-specific challenges, regulatory constraints, and organizational objectives.
Begin by fostering close communication with business analysts, product owners, and other non-technical stakeholders.
Regularly attend meetings where business strategies are discussed.
Continuous industry research and case study analysis can also provide insights.
Security Concerns
The cloud introduces unique security challenges, from data breaches to misconfigured permissions.
Familiarize yourself with cloud security best practices.
Consider obtaining security-specific cloud certifications. For example, AWS Certified Security Specialty.
Utilize tools provided by cloud platforms, such as AWS's Security Hub and GuardDuty, for monitoring and recommendations.
Cost Management
Cloud services operate on a pay-as-you-go or reserved model. Inefficient architecture can lead to escalated costs.
Understand the pricing model of each service.
Utilize cost management tools like AWS Cost Explorer.
Implement cost-saving architectures like auto-scaling, using spot or reserved EC2 instances or savings plans, using serverless technologies like AWS Lambda and NoSQL databases like AWS DynamoDB.
Cost optimization is a powerful skills to have as a Cloud Solutions Architect.
Multi-cloud Environments
With organizations often using multiple cloud providers, mastering just one platform isn't sufficient.
Try to diversify your learning.
After mastering one platform, start exploring others.
Understand interoperability challenges and familiarize yourself with multi-cloud management tools.
Soft Skills Development
Beyond technical expertise, architects must effectively communicate with diverse teams, manage projects, and sometimes handle conflict resolution.
Attend soft skills workshops, practice public speaking, and engage in cross-departmental meetings.
Feedback from peers and mentors can be invaluable.
Learn how to write.
Learning to write clearly and effectively is a superpower since you will be asked to write technical documentation and document design decisions.
Staying Relevant
The tech field, especially cloud computing, evolves rapidly.
Skills and tools that are relevant today might become obsolete tomorrow.
Subscribe to industry blogs, join cloud forums, and participate in community discussions. (Show some love and share my newsletter with your social network 😉 )
Engage in continuous learning and consider dedicating a few hours each week to explore new services or tools.
Hands-on Experience
Theory and practice often diverge. Without hands-on experience, theoretical knowledge can remain abstract.
Create personal projects or volunteer for diverse projects within your organization. Sign up for AWS Skill Builder to learn from AWS experts.
Addressing these challenges requires proactive learning, real-world exposure, and continuous feedback.
A holistic approach that balances technical acumen, business understanding, and interpersonal skills is critical to succeeding as a Cloud Solutions Architect.
2 Tweets of the week
Whenever you’re ready, there are 3 ways I can help you:
Are you thinking about getting certified as a Google Cloud Digital Leader? Here’s a link to my Udemy course, which has helped 445+ students prepare and pass the exam. Currently, rated 4.89/5. (link)
I have also published a book to help you prepare and pass the Google Cloud Digital Leader exam. You can check it out on Amazon. (link)
Course Recommendation: AWS Courses by Adrian Cantrill (Certified + Job Ready):
AWS Solutions Architect Associate (link)
AWS Developer Associate: (link)
ALL THE THINGS Bundle: (link)
Note: These are affiliate links. That means I get paid a small commission with no additional cost to you. It also helps support this newsletter. 😃
Thank you for investing your time in reading this post.🙏
I'm always looking for topics that resonate with my audience. If there's a specific subject you'd like to know more about or discuss, I welcome you to reply right here.
Please know that each message I receive is read and valued.
Your feedback matters! I genuinely appreciate your thoughts on this issue. Your comments, praise, criticism, and suggestions all play a pivotal role in shaping my content.
Together, we can make this a fruitful and enjoyable exploration of knowledge.
And, if you found value in this newsletter issue and think others might too, it would mean the world to me if you could take a few moments to share it with your loved ones, colleagues, friends, or anyone who might benefit.
Let's keep the conversation going, keep learning, and amplify the power of shared knowledge!